Mathematics at University of Alabama

Ranked 77th of 327 bachelor's programs in Mathematics by 5-year earnings.

Median · 1 year out
$52,255
middle 50%: $35,348 – $73,373
Median · 5 years out
$73,423
middle 50%: $55,655 – $105,760
Median · 10 years out
$91,284
middle 50%: $66,346 – $125,457

Salary trajectory

Median earnings vs the national median for Mathematics (bachelor's) graduates.

This program (median)National median, same major & degreeMiddle 50% of graduates

Mathematics graduates command a $52k median salary in their first year. This figure reaches $91k after a decade in the field.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au PSEO, release V4.13.0 2025Q4. Earnings are for graduates working in covered states; figures are medians in nominal dollars.
